CABINET MEETING.
LEGISLATIVE COUNCIL APPOINTMENTS. RE-AKRANGEMENT OF PORTFOLIOS.
(By Telegraph.—Parliamentary Reporter.)
WELLINGTON, this day. A lengthy or Cabinet was held to-day. The Premier, interviewed later, stated that it had been decided to re-appoint the Eons. Reid and Jenkinson to the Legislative Council, and that a redistribution t>f portfolios would be arranged in a day or two.
Sir Joseph said he expected the Land Bill would be brought down during this week.
